Harris v. Phillips Pipe Line Company
Citations
- 517 S.W.2d 361
- 50 Oil & Gas Rep. 370
- 1974 Tex. App. LEXIS 2816
How courts have described this case
Verbatim parenthetical descriptions written by other courts when citing this decision. Ranked by citation-network relevance.
- discussing landowner’s grant to Shell Oil as “patently .,. very broad” and .including “the right to ‘construct, reconstruct, replace, renew, maintain, repair, change the size of[,] and remove pipes and pipe lines’”
- construing general-purpose easement granting “the- right of way from time to time to lay, construct, reconstruct, replace, renew, maintain, repair, change the size of and remove pipes and pipe lines for the transportation of oil, petroleum, or any of its products”
